How Does Your Credit Report Impact Your Home Mortgage Rate?
Your credit score straight figures out the rate of interest a lending institution provides you, which influences your month-to-month payment for the entire life of the financing. A score above 740 generally certifies you for the best conventional funding rates, while ratings between 620 and 739 still unlock to affordable options.
New purchasers often take too lightly how much a solitary portion factor difference in their home mortgage rate transforms the total cost of a home. On a $450,000 lending, the distinction between a 6.5% rate and a 7.5% price adds up to countless dollars per year. Draw your credit score report early, pay for revolving equilibriums, and stay clear of opening new accounts in the months before you use. Lenders who offer bank loans in California property buyers rely on will review your full credit profile before providing a pre-approval letter.
How to Improve Your Credit Scores Prior To Applying
Paying your bills in a timely manner for 6 consecutive months produces a measurable favorable influence on your rating. Decreasing your credit report usage ratio listed below 30% on each card adds additional points. Contesting any kind of mistakes on your credit scores report with the significant bureaus is a complimentary action that lots of customers neglect.
What Are the very best Funding Programs for First-Time Purchasers in Waterfront?
FHA financings, conventional fundings, and CalHFA programs each serve various customer accounts, and selecting the appropriate one relies on your earnings, savings, and long-lasting goals. FHA financings call for as little as 3.5% down and approve reduced credit report, making them a prominent selection for new customers in the Waterfront location.
The The Golden State Real estate Financing Firm runs state-specific deposit assistance programs that pair well with FHA and conventional car loans. These programs assist purchasers cover upfront costs, which is one of the biggest barriers to homeownership along the Central Method hallway where typical home rates have actually appreciated steadily. Standard car loans with a 3% or 5% deposit likewise continue to be competitive, especially if your credit rating certifies you for a reduced private home loan insurance policy price.
Comprehending Down Payment Aid in The Golden State
Down payment aid in The golden state usually comes in the type of a deferred loan or a quiet second mortgage. You do not make regular monthly payments on a deferred lending till you offer, re-finance, or settle the initial home loan. Buyers that plan to remain in their Riverside home for at least five years commonly profit most from these programs because the assistance appreciates together with the home.

What Papers You Need for Pre-Approval
Gathering your records ahead of time shortens the pre-approval timeline substantially. You will certainly require your 2 latest pay stubs, 2 years of W-2 kinds, two months of bank statements, a government-issued ID, and your Social Security number. Self-employed buyers additionally need two years of federal tax returns together with a year-to-date profit and loss statement prepared by an accredited accounting professional.
Just How Do Property Taxes and Insurance Policy Affect Your Regular Monthly Repayment in Riverside?
Property taxes in Riverside Region and house owners insurance both element into your month-to-month home mortgage repayment with your escrow account. Purchasers usually concentrate just on the principal and rate of interest section of their payment, but taxes and insurance policy can add numerous hundred bucks monthly to the overall amount due.
Waterfront County real estate tax average about 1.1% of a home's examined value annually. A home purchased for $480,000 generates roughly $5,280 in annual real estate tax, or $440 each month added to your escrow. Homeowners insurance coverage in inland Southern The golden state also reflects the region's direct exposure to warm and seasonal fire risk, so going shopping numerous insurance policy service providers prior to shutting safeguards your budget plan. What Should First-Time Customers Understand About the Closing Process?
Closing on a home in California takes in between 30 and 45 days from the moment your offer is approved. Throughout that home window, your lending institution orders an evaluation, completes your financing data, and collaborates with a title firm to move possession.
Closing costs in California typically range from 2% to 5% of the acquisition cost, covering lending institution fees, title insurance, escrow charges, and prepaid things like property owners insurance policy and real estate tax books. New customers in the Central Avenue Riverside area occasionally negotiate with sellers to cover a portion of shutting costs, which minimizes the cash you need to give the closing table. Recognizing these numbers ahead of time avoids last-minute surprises that can postpone or hinder a transaction.
Typical Novice Customer Mistakes to Prevent
Making a large acquisition on credit rating between pre-approval and closing changes your debt-to-income ratio and can cause the lender pulling your approval. Transforming tasks throughout the very same window produces documentation challenges that slow-moving the process. Skipping the home assessment to save cash exposes you to fix costs that might surpass the expense of the assessment often times over. How much earnings do I need to buy a home in Riverside, CA?
Lenders usually desire your total monthly debt settlements, including your brand-new mortgage, to remain listed below 43% of your gross month-to-month income. For a $450,000 home with 5% down, you generally need a gross month-to-month income of at least $8,500 to certify easily.
Can I get a home in Waterfront with pupil finance financial obligation?
Yes. Lenders element student financing repayments into your debt-to-income proportion however do not automatically invalidate you. Income-driven repayment strategies and finance forgiveness programs can boost your qualifying proportions.
What is the minimum down payment for a new purchaser in California?
FHA finances need best site 3.5% down with a credit score of 580 or greater. Standard finances allow as low as 3% down through specific first-time purchaser programs. Deposit support from state and regional agencies can additionally lower what you bring to closing.
How much time does it take to get a home mortgage in California?
Pre-approval typically takes 24 to 72 hours once you submit your full paperwork. Complete lending closing takes 30 to 45 days from the accepted offer day in the majority of Riverside Area purchases.
